"87 Tryst Park is a generously proportioned, detached house occupying a corner plot with gardens to all 4 sides. This beautifully presented family home benefits from a south facing aspect with stunning views of the Pentland Hills, versatile accommodation and off street parking.

The downstairs consists of a welcoming hall with storage cupboard; generous sitting room with a wood burning stove and patio doors to the conservatory; a kitchen with a range of wall mounted and floor standing units, integrated appliances and space and plumbing for a washing machine; dining room; guest WC and a large conservatory with patio doors leading directly on decking. Upstairs there is a principal double bedroom with a dual aspect, dressing area and built in wardrobes; double bedroom 2 with built in wardrobes; double bedroom 3 with built in wardrobes; and a family bathroom room with white three piece suite comprising WC, double wash hand basin and bath with shower over. There is a partially floored loft.

To the front of the property is a monoblock driveway with parking for 3 cars and giving access to a lock up with up and over door and utility room.

Gardens surrounding the property with lawn, mature borders, decking and patios.

Gas central heating. Double glazing. The south facing roof benefits from solar panels.

EPC Rating C

Council Tax G

Location

Fairmilehead is a popular residential area to the south of the city centre. A great range of shopping facilities is available locally and in nearby Morningside, which boasts a Waitrose Supermarket, a Marks & Spencer Food Store and a wide range of boutique shops and cafes. The property is well located for the Edinburgh City Bypass giving easy access to the Straiton Retail Outlet with its good variety of high street shops, as well as Edinburgh Business Park, Edinburgh International Airport and the wider road network in central Scotland including the A1, M8 and M9. Regular bus services also run to and from the city centre and the area is well served at both Primary and Secondary school level. Recreational facilities include Hillend Snowsports Centre offering the 2nd longest dry ski slope in Europe, several golf courses and the Pentland Hills Regional Park offering mountain biking, hill walking and fishing being just a few of the activities available."
